Summary of March 7th Open Meeting

March 7, 2018

The Public Service Commission of the District of Columbia (Commission) approved four actions items before the Commission at its March 7th Open Meeting.

The matters include:

1. Formal Case No. 977, In the Matter of the Investigation into the Quality of Service of Washington Gas Light Company, District of Columbia Division, in the District of Columbia. This Order accepts Washington Gas Light Company’s (WGL) Natural Gas Quality of Service Standards Annual Report for Calendar Year 2017 and grants WGL’s Request for Waiver of Commission Rules §§ 3702.2, 3704.3 and 3704.8.

2. Formal Case No. 988, In the Matter of the Development of Universal Service Standards and the Universal Service Trust Fund for the District of Columbia. This Order and Notice of Final Tariff approves Verizon Washington, DC Inc.’s Application proposing its District of Columbia Universal Service Trust Fund 2018 surcharge. The 2018 surcharge tariff shall become effective upon publication of a Notice of Final Tariff in the D.C. Register. 
3. Formal Case No. 1017, In the Matter of the Development and Designation of Standard Offer Service in the District of Columbia. This Order approves the Potomac Electric Power Company’s (Pepco) revised proposed retail rates, including the administrative charges, for Standard Offer Service (SOS); grants Pepco’s Motion for Enlargement of Time to File 2018-2019 SOS Retail Rates; and accepts Pepco’s proposed retail rates, as well as Pepco’s revised proposed retail SOS rates filed, including administrative charges, into the record. Pepco shall file a revised tariff setting forth the new retail rates for SOS within seven calendar days of the date of this Order. The new rates shall become effective on June 1, 2018.

4. Formal Case No. 1150, In the Matter of the Application of Potomac Electric Power Company for Authority to Increase Existing Retail Rates and Charges for Electric Distribution Service and Formal Case No. 1151, In the Matter of the Impact of the Tax Cuts and Jobs Act of 2017 on the Existing Distribution Service Rates and Charges for Potomac Electric Power Company and Washington Gas Light Company. This Order grants the Motion for Abeyance filed by the Potomac Electric Power Company and its Motion to Waive the Issues List; grants the Motion for Leave to Respond to Order No. 19263 filed by the Office of the People’s Counsel and accepts its Response into the record of this proceeding. Response times to discovery requests are revised as set forth in this Order, and the procedural schedule attached to this Order is adopted in the event there is no settlement agreement.
